Basal Ganglia
Groups of nuclei in the brain associated with a variety of functions, including control of voluntary motor movements, procedural learning, and habits.
Huntington's Disease
A genetic disorder that causes the progressive breakdown of nerve cells in the brain, leading to physical, cognitive, and psychological symptoms.
Cortex
The outer layer of the cerebrum in the brain, involved in complex functions such as thought, perception, and memory.
